Accommodation
Glenmoriston is an ideal spot to be based for touring the very best that the Highlands has to offer and there is a wealth of accommodation available to suit most requirements. Invermoriston is also one of the traditional overnight stopping points for those travelling along The Great Glen Way and there are a variety of options for single-night stays for travellers passing through.

Glenmoriston Arms Hotel
Originating from 1740, which pre-dates the Battle of Culloden, this traditional family run Highland Hotel offers accommodation, a cosy bar with a temptingly well stocked whisky shelf, lounge, restaurant, outside seating...... and a warm welcome.

Briar Bank
Briar Bank is located in the small hamlet of Alltsigh, on the A82 midway between Fort Augustus and Drumnadrochit, just 100 yards from The Great Glen Way and overlooking Loch Ness. A short walk will take you to the shore where you can look out for Nessie! May and Duncan are the proud hosts; breakfast is made by Duncan wearing his kilt.
